在CSS中,标签之间的优先级是按顺序排列的。这意味着,第一个标签具有更高的优先级,第二个标签具有更低的优先级。如果希望在标签之间添加样式,需要确保它们在正确的优先级级别上。
要给同级标签加样式,可以使用“!”符号来声明一个类,这个类将覆盖当前标签的所有属性。例如,如果要给“p”标签添加背景颜色,可以使用以下CSS代码:
“`css
background-color: #ff0000; /* 使用颜色值 */
在上面的代码中,“!”符号被用来声明一个名为“background-color”的类,它将覆盖“p”标签的所有属性,包括背景颜色。如果只使用一个颜色值,可以在类中直接使用它,例如:
“`css
background-color: #ff0000; /* 使用颜色值 */
除了使用“!”符号外,还可以使用其他CSS属性来控制标签的样式,例如:
1. 使用伪类名
可以使用伪类名来给标签添加样式。例如,使用“:first-child”伪类可以只给第一个“p”标签添加背景颜色:
“`css
p:first-child {
background-color: #ff0000; /* 使用颜色值 */
在上面的代码中,“:first-child”伪类被用来指定“p”标签的第一个子标签。
2. 使用属性值
可以使用属性值来给标签添加样式。例如,使用“color”属性可以只给“p”标签添加文本颜色:
“`css
color: #ff0000; /* 使用颜色值 */
在上面的代码中,“color”属性被用来指定“p”标签的文本颜色。
无论使用哪种方法,给同级标签加样式都可以使页面更加美观和易于阅读。通过使用正确的CSS属性,可以轻松地控制元素的样式,使网站更具吸引力和可读性。